Bowe not fit to face France
Ireland winger Tommy Bowe will not feature in Sunday’s RBS 6 Nations clash with France at the Aviva Stadium.
Bowe, who missed the opener against Italy in Rome on Saturday, has been ruled out of contention as he continues his rehabilitation from a knee injury.
Stephen Ferris, Jamie Heaslip and Andrew Trimble have all been recalled to the 33-man squad, however.
Heaslip continues to make good progress in his recovery from an ankle injury and could play a part against the French.
An additional eight players have been called into the squad to supplement the 22 on duty at Stadio Flaminio – Brett Wilkinson, Mick O’Driscoll, Donnacha Ryan, Mike McCarthy, Nevin Spence, Johne Murphy, Andrew Trimble and Gavin Duffy.
Declan Kidney will name his team on Wednesday.
